The power grid system market comprises products such as transmission and distribution equipment used for effective monitoring, controlling, and distribution of electricity. Power grid systems aid in efficiently managing electricity production as well as distribution across rural and urban areas. Further, advancements in smart grid technologies play a vital role in seamlessly integrating renewable energy and distributed energy resources into existing grids. The adoption of smart grids enables two-way communication between utilities and consumers, improves grid efficiency & reliability, and enhances power delivery.

Current Challenges in Power Grid System Market

The Power Grid System Market Demand is facing several challenges currently. With growing populations and rapid urbanization, the demand for electricity is increasing tremendously which is putting pressure on existing power generation and distribution infrastructure. Aging power grids in many countries can no longer cope up with rising demand safely and reliably. Power outages and blackouts have become more frequent. Maintaining grid stability with higher integration of renewable energy like solar and wind is also a major issue due to their intermittent nature. Utilities need to invest heavily in modernizing aging assets, grid automation, and adoption of smart grid technologies to make power delivery more efficient, flexible and resilient to meet future energy needs sustainably. Lack of funding, budget constraints of utilities, and high initial costs of installation hamper grid upgradation projects. Geopolitical tensions and stringent environmental regulations further complicate infrastructure development.
